上一页 1 ··· 9 10 11 12 13 14 15 16 17 ··· 29 下一页
摘要: 1.1 CodeSmith一款人气很旺国外的基于模板的dotnet代码生成器官方网站:http://www.codesmithtools.com官方论坛:http://forum.codesmithtools.com/default.aspx版权形式:30天试用开源:否需要先注册确认后才能下载1.2 MyGeneratorMyGenerator是又一个国外很不错的代码生成工具,有人觉得比CodeSmith简单、好用。所有api可以在帮助菜单中找到。官方网站:http://www.mygenerationsoftware.com/portal/default.aspx官方论坛:版权形式:免费开源 阅读全文
posted @ 2011-12-22 12:50 skyme 阅读(120211) 评论(27) 推荐(25) 编辑
摘要: 第一章 phonegap介绍1.1 什么是phonegapPhoneGap是一个自由开放源码的开发工具和框架,允许利用HTML + JavaScript + CSS的强大功能在多个手机平台上开发程序,开发出来的程序经过在各自的平台上编译形成独立的安装程序。使程序看起来和native的程序一样。1.2 PhoneGap的优势和劣势优势:l 跨平台:一次开发,多个平台共用。现主要包括了android,iOS,Apple iOS, Google Android, Palm, Symbian, BlackBerry 等。WP7等平台也在逐步兼容中。l 降低开发门槛。对于很多WEB开发人员来说,熟悉Ob 阅读全文
posted @ 2011-12-21 13:00 skyme 阅读(7333) 评论(11) 推荐(7) 编辑
摘要: 1、缓存,在持久层或持久层之上做缓存。2、数据库表的大字段剥离,保证单条记录的数据量很小。3、恰当地使用索引。4、必要时建立多级索引。5、分析Oracle的执行计划,通过表数据统计等方式协助数据库走正确的查询方式,该走索引就走索引,该走全表扫描就走全表扫描。6、表分区和拆分,无论是业务逻辑上的拆分(如一个月一张报表、分库)还是无业务含义的分区(如根据ID取模分区)。7、RAC。8、字段冗余,减少跨库查询和大表连接操作。9、数据通过单个或多个JOB生成出来,减少实时查询。10、从磁盘上做文章,数据存放的在磁盘的内、外磁道上,数据获取的效率都是不一样的。11、放弃关系数据库的某些特性,引入NoSQ 阅读全文
posted @ 2011-12-07 10:34 skyme 阅读(937) 评论(0) 推荐(0) 编辑
摘要: 1、罐子满了吗在一次关于项目管理的课上,教授在桌子上放了一个装水的罐子,然后又从桌子下面拿出一些可以从罐口放进罐子里的“鹅卵石”。当教授把石块放完后,正好堆满整个罐子。这时教授问他的学生:“你们说,这罐子现在是不是满了?” “是”所有的学生异口同声地回答说。“真的吗?”教授笑着问。然后又从桌子底下拿出一袋碎石子,把碎石子从罐口倒下去,摇一摇,再加一些,再问学生:“你们说,这罐子现在是不是满的?”这回他的学生不敢回答得太快。最后班上有位学生怯生生地细声回答道:“也 许没满。” “很好!”教授说完后,又从桌下拿出一袋沙子,慢慢地倒进罐子里。倒完后,于是再问班上的学生:“现在你们再告诉我,这个罐子 阅读全文
posted @ 2011-12-05 15:33 skyme 阅读(9192) 评论(0) 推荐(0) 编辑
摘要: 简介团队的开发人员撇开需求沉浸在想象中的“完美”程序中;测试人员迷茫的点击着按钮试图搞明白这到底是个什么功能;设计师造出了没有尽头 的楼梯,更糟的是,客户爱上了这个设计;团队领导四处救火,力有不逮。种种迹象表明,我们得打破分工带来的壁垒,建设全功能团队——大多数人能完成大多数 种类工作的团队。在一次闲聊中,女友的母亲说起实习大夫必须轮岗一年才会进行分科学习,我质疑道:“对于致力于心脏病治疗的医生来说,他岂 不是在不相干的学习上浪费了一年时间么?”,她母亲笑着说:“不这么作,你怎么确信病人的确患有心脏病呢?”。不知道为什么,我眼前突然浮现出这样的场 景?测试人员在怯生生的询问:“这是一个缺陷么( 阅读全文
posted @ 2011-12-05 12:54 skyme 阅读(783) 评论(0) 推荐(0) 编辑
摘要: PORTAL是什么portal是一个基于web的应用,它能提供个性化,单点登陆,不同源的内容聚合,和信息系统的表示层集中。聚合是整合不同web页面源数据的过程。为了提供用户定制的内容,portal可能包含复杂的个性化特征。为不同用户创建内容的portal页,可能包含不同的portlet集。 表示了portal的基本架构。portal web应用处理客户请求,找回用户当前页中的portlet,然后调用portlet容器,从新获取各个portlet的内容。portlet容器提供portlet的运行时环境,并通过portlet api调用portlet。portal通过portlet invok.. 阅读全文
posted @ 2011-11-26 13:17 skyme 阅读(7126) 评论(0) 推荐(1) 编辑
摘要: WSO2的应用服务器WSO2的应用服务器是基于WSO2 Carbon平台的企业级就绪的应用程序服务器。继承的WSO2 Web服务应用服务器(WSAS),WSO2的应用服务器(AS)支持除了其Web服务管理功能的Web应用程序部署和管理。加上WSO2的Carbon功能,用户现在有能力管理他们的应用程序,范围从Web服务,Web应用程序在一个统一的方式在应用程序服务器管理控制台本身。Web服务规范的基础上面向服务的架构(SOA)的概念,支持安全,可靠和事务集成基于松散耦合,这是固有的可扩展性的概念。许多厂商已经支持Web服务和XML到他们现有的专有产品解决方案。 WSO2公司创造了一个新的平台,削 阅读全文
posted @ 2011-11-26 11:23 skyme 阅读(3449) 评论(0) 推荐(3) 编辑
摘要: Mvc4g是一个简单的框架来实现的GWT应用程序的MVC模式。主要思想其主要思想是,以减轻开发人员的工作,以单独的视图从模型。该框架是一个XML文件,将允许开发人员告诉视图发射事件时要执行什么样的行动需要配置。框架如何工作具体步骤如下图事件是创建活动的视图控制器。事件包含两部分信息:执行的动作的名称对象传递到行动UserBean user = new UserBean();user.setName("John Smith");new Event("CreateUser", user);控制器控制器接收事件,并根据事件动作的名称,执行的行动。例如,如果您有 阅读全文
posted @ 2011-11-23 09:15 skyme 阅读(713) 评论(0) 推荐(1) 编辑
摘要: GWT是什么如今,编写网络应用程序是一个单调乏味且易于出错的过程。开发人员可能要花费 90% 的时间来处理浏览器行话。此外,构建、重复使用以及维护大量 JavaScript 代码库和 AJAX 组件可能困难且不可靠。Google Web Toolkit (GWT) 允许开发人员使用 Java 编程语言快速构建和维护复杂而又高性能的 JavaScript 前端应用程序,从而降低了开发难度,尤其是与 Eclipse Google 插件结合使用时,优势更明显。 google的官方说的很详细http://code.google.com/intl/zh-CN/webtoolkit/overview.ht 阅读全文
posted @ 2011-11-22 15:58 skyme 阅读(1972) 评论(0) 推荐(2) 编辑
摘要: Jbpm-gwt-console源码编译从svn下载,svn的下载地址是http://anonsvn.jboss.org/repos/soag/bpm-console/tags/bpm-console-2.1下载之后使用mvn进行编译当中遇到本很多问题,可以通过以下的网站进行jar包的查找和处理https://repository.sonatype.org/index.html#welcome mvn仓库http://www.java2s.com/ jar包查找http://grepcode.com/ jar包查找因为本地使用的是nexus,所以可能有一些jar包找不到,那么可以先下载jar包 阅读全文
posted @ 2011-11-17 16:06 skyme 阅读(1772) 评论(1) 推荐(3) 编辑
上一页 1 ··· 9 10 11 12 13 14 15 16 17 ··· 29 下一页